Primary Purpose of Organizational Unit Since 1966, researchers at the Carolina Population Center have pioneered data collection and research techniques that move population science forward by emphasizing life course approaches, longitudinal surveys, the integration of biological measurement into social surveys, and attention to context and environment. We are also at the forefront of creating interdisciplinary training programs that integrate approaches from the social and biological sciences, building research capacity and training the next generation of scholars. Our faculty fellows address pressing research questions about population dynamics, fertility, health, mortality, migration, and the environment. Faculty come from multiple disciplines, benefitting from the cross-pollination of ideas. Our dedicated research and programming staff support fellows at every stage of project development, from conception through data collection or acquisition, analysis and dissemination, and project administration.

//www.cpc.unc.edu/about/ Position Summary The Global Food Research Program (GFRP) Research Specialist will be responsible for leading the development and execution of the study design for the Lola’s 2.0 project to develop an AI-powered personalized grocery store to promote healthy, sustainable food choices. This will include working with data scientists and nutritionists to set up and organize the data, use Amazon Web Services to build the database and algorithms, and lead efforts to validate the algorithm. The GFRP Research Specialist will also lead data analysis and manuscript preparation. Minimum Education and Experience Requirements Bachelor’s degree in a discipline related to the field assigned and one year of related training or experience; or equivalent combination of training and experience. All degrees must be received from appropriately accredited institutions. Required Qualifications, Competencies, and Experience Experience with data analysis. Experience with manuscript preparation.
